By Wynn Netherland, Nathan Weizenbaum, Chris Eppstein, Brandon Mathis
Sass and Compass in motion is the definitive advisor to stylesheet authoring utilizing those progressive instruments. Written for either designers and builders, this publication demonstrates the facility of either Sass and Compass via a chain of examples that handle universal soreness issues linked to conventional stylesheet authoring. The e-book starts with basic themes similar to CSS resets and strikes directly to extra concerned themes reminiscent of grid frameworks and CSS3 seller implementation differences.
About this Book
For 15 years, we've been utilizing CSS to patiently paint the internet through hand. not more! Sass and Compass upload scripting and a library of elements to straightforward CSS so that you can simplify stylesheet authoring, automate tedious initiatives, and upload dynamic styling positive factors in your pages. contemplate Sass and Compass as strength instruments that let you paint with awesome pace and precision.
Sass and Compass in motion is a hands-on advisor to stylesheet authoring utilizing those innovative instruments. This sensible e-book exhibits you ways to do away with universal CSS ache issues and focus on making your pages pop. You'll start with basic subject matters like CSS resets after which development to extra mammoth demanding situations like construction a private stylesheet framework to package and reuse your personal methods and evaluations.
Read Online or Download Sass and Compass in Action PDF
Similar web development books
Origin model regulate for net builders explains how model regulate works, what you are able to do with it and the way. utilizing a pleasant and available tone, you'll how you can use the 3 prime model keep an eye on systems—Subversion, Git and Mercurial—on a number of working structures. The background and quintessential suggestions of model regulate are lined so you will achieve an intensive figuring out of the topic, and why it's going to be used to regulate all adjustments in internet improvement initiatives.
Achieve optimum site velocity and function with this Wrox guide
Professional web site functionality: Optimizing front finish and again finish deals crucial details to aid either front-end and back-end technicians be certain greater site performance.
Foreword through Chris Coyier.
Let's face it: CSS is tough. Our stylesheets are extra complicated than they was, and we're bending the spec to do up to it may. Can Sass help?
A reluctant convert to Sass, Dan Cederholm stocks how he came over to the preferred CSS pre-processor, and offers a uncomplicated route to taking larger keep watch over of your code (all the whereas operating how you continuously have). From getting began to complicated thoughts, Dan can help you point up your stylesheets and immediately begin profiting from the ability of Sass.
Contents: - Why Sass? - Sass Workflow - utilizing Sass - Sass and Media Queries. - Dan Cederholm is a dressmaker, writer, and speaker dwelling in Salem, Massachusetts. He's the Co-Founder of Dribbble, a group for designers, and founding father of SimpleBits, a tiny layout studio. A long-time suggest of standards-based website design, Dan has labored with YouTube, Microsoft, Google, MTV, ESPN and others. He's written a number of renowned books approximately website design, and obtained a TechFellow award in early 2012. He's at the moment an aspiring clawhammer banjoist and sometimes wears a baseball cap.
Over 70 functional recnonfiction, programming, net improvement, djangoipes to create multilingual, responsive, and scalable web content with Django
About This booklet
• enhance your talents by means of constructing types, kinds, perspectives, and templates
• a realistic advisor to writing and utilizing APIs to import or export info
Who This publication Is For
If you've got created web pages with Django, yet you need to sharpen your wisdom and examine a few reliable ways for a way to regard diversified facets of net improvement, make sure you learn this publication. it truly is meant for intermediate Django clients who have to construct initiatives which has to be multilingual, useful on units of other reveal sizes, and which scale through the years.
What you are going to research
• Configure your Django undertaking the ideal means
• construct a database constitution out of reusable version mixins
• deal with hierarchical buildings with MPTT
• Create convenient template filters and tags for you to reuse in each venture
• grasp the configuration of contributed management
• expand Django CMS along with your personal performance
Django is simple to benefit and solves every kind of internet improvement difficulties and questions, offering Python builders a simple option to web-application improvement. With a wealth of third-party modules to be had, you'll manage to create a hugely customizable internet software with this robust framework.
Web improvement with Django Cookbook will consultant you thru all net improvement techniques with the Django framework. you'll get began with the digital atmosphere and configuration of the undertaking, after which you are going to the best way to outline a database constitution with reusable elements. the best way to tweak the management to make the web site editors satisfied. This booklet offers with a few very important third-party modules worthy for totally outfitted net improvement.
- Mobile First
- Pro JSF and HTML5: Building Rich Internet Components
- 20 Recipes for Programming MVC 3: Faster, Smarter Web Development
- Smashing eBook #28 Mobile Design Patterns
Extra info for Sass and Compass in Action
GO FORTH AND HOVER-CRAFT As I mentioned before, this solution has affected the way I think about creating the asset graphics for a design. We can use opacity to control how the graphic appears by default, blending it into the background—then applying a different value for :hover, :focus, and :active states, tying it together with a transition for browsers that support it. Keep the opacity property in mind next time you’re creating hover treatments for hyperlinked images in your own designs. You’ll save time, bandwidth, and the unnecessary complexity that other solutions might require.
Normally I wouldn’t suggest using filter, as (unlike vendorprefixed properties) it’s not part of any proposed standard. Also, use of the filter property can bring increased performance overhead depending on where or how often it’s used. It’s a hack—but it provides a means to an end. So long as you understand this, and perhaps quarantine the use of this property to its own stylesheet or else carefully comment it, then it can be a viable method. Microsoft. Microsoft. » Alpha(Opacity=60)"; /* IE 8 hack */ filter: alpha(opacity = 60); /* IE 5-7 hack */ } The syntax is similar, with a value of opacity passed through IE’s alpha filter.
Here’s where specifying a backup color comes into play. When using RGBA to assign color values, it’s good practice to specify a solid color first, as a fallback for browsers that don’t yet support RGBA. 7); } Browsers that do support RGBA will override the solid color (a light gray #ccc in this case), while browsers that don’t yet support RGBA yet will ignore the RGBA rule. So, an important point to remember: specify solid backups for RGBA colors in a separate rule that appears before the RGBA rule.